Higher level skills help, but low level Slayer is generally a good way to start with moneymaking. You can also kill dragons, tan dragonhides, make cannonballs, or charge orbs. At higher levels you unlock better Slayer monsters like Skeletal Wyverns. You can also do herb runs, set up Nightmare Zone and collect your daily herb boxes as a reward from doing that.

I don't know about good money makers with low requirement, but i can list some good moneymakers for you.

 

Dailys:

Kingdom 

Farming Herbs

Battlestaffs from Varrock diary

 

Other methods:

Runecrafting Nats/Laws

Red/Black chinchompas

Zulrah, GWD PVM, or pvm in general

 

But the best way will always be flipping if you know what you are doing and get a decent capital do work with

 

And tbh fishing woodcutting mining fletching and crafting are pretty bad money making skills

Buying iron ore and ring of forging (so no lost ores) then smelt and smith into iron knifes, i just did 1k ores and profited about 300k
